Reckitt Benckiser’s First Quarter Net Income up 17%

Reckitt Benckiser PLC, London, said its pretax profit for the three months to March 31 was GBP111 million, compared with a year-earlier GBP96 million. Net revenues grew 2% (6% constant) to GBP874 million. Net revenues from continuing operations grew 3% (6% constant).Gross margin increased 260 bps to 53.4% due to favorable long-term contracts, higher margin new products and savings from ongoing cost optimization programs, Squeeze and Xtrim.
